Wat Ketmakee Sri Wararam
Wat Ketmakee is a huge temple on the side of the main highway from Bangkok to Phetchaburi. We had driven by this temple many times and never found the time to visit it until September 2007, which turned out to be a quite interesting visit. In the huge temple hall are three large Buddha images and one small white marble image of Phra Buddha Sihing. In the temple building the monks were working out with barbells, something we had never seen before. The images available for "rent" had a very high price and we felt somewhat un-easy at the pressure also from the nuns at the temple to spend money. If you don't have money, you will not find this temple a place for pure worship but an interesting temple to visit.
